How Farming Technology and Solar Power Can Combat Hyperinflation

In regions affected by hyperinflation, such as many developing countries, the agricultural sector often faces significant challenges. Food prices skyrocket, making it difficult for farmers to afford essential inputs and for consumers to access affordable produce. However, the combination of innovative farming technology and the adoption of solar power offers a promising solution to combat hyperinflation's impact on food production and availability. Farming technology, including precision farming, hydroponics, and vertical farming, plays a crucial role in maximizing the efficiency of agricultural operations. These technologies help farmers produce more food in less space and with fewer resources, making them less vulnerable to the fluctuations in prices caused by hyperinflation. For example, precision farming allows farmers to optimize the use of fertilizers and pesticides, reducing costs while increasing yields. Hydroponic and vertical farming systems enable year-round production in controlled environments, further enhancing productivity and resilience to market disruptions. In addition to advanced farming techniques, the adoption of solar power presents a sustainable energy solution for farmers facing rising electricity costs due to hyperinflation. Solar panels can be installed on farms to generate clean and renewable energy, reducing reliance on costly grid electricity or fossil fuels. With solar power, farmers can power irrigation systems, lighting, and other equipment needed for efficient farming operations, all while lowering operational expenses and mitigating the impact of hyperinflated prices on their bottom line. Furthermore, the integration of solar power with farming technology creates a synergistic approach that enhances the overall resilience of agricultural systems. By combining innovative farming practices with renewable energy sources, farmers can not only increase productivity and reduce operating costs but also contribute to environmental sustainability. Solar-powered irrigation systems, for instance, can improve water efficiency and crop yields, leading to greater food security and economic stability in hyperinflationary environments. In conclusion, the convergence of farming technology and solar power offers a viable pathway for farmers to navigate the challenges posed by hyperinflation. By leveraging advanced agricultural practices and sustainable energy solutions, farmers can adapt to volatile market conditions, improve productivity, and ensure food security for their communities. As the global community seeks to address the impacts of hyperinflation on food systems, investing in innovative solutions that empower farmers with the tools they need to thrive is essential for building a more resilient and sustainable future.
